On Mar 21, 7:39 am, AMCD wrote:
the query is to tell if cells eg: a1 and a2 have more than a 10% disparity preferably always using the lower number to calculate the 10% variation. =if(abs(a1-a2)/min(a1,a2)10%, true, false) Caveat: This assumes that both A1 and A2 are greater than zero. |
